CORA L. MCLEOD WINTERPORT – Cora Lewis McLeod, 87, wife of the late Lewis L. McLeod died Sept. 12, 2005, at a Bangor hospital. She was born May 27, 1918, in Johnson City, N.Y., the daughter of Will C. and Florence D. (Blaisdell) Lewis. Cora attended school in Binghamton, N.Y. and in 1928 moved to Winterport. She attended Winterport schools graduating from Winterport High School in 1936, she also graduated from Gilman Commercial College in Bangor. She married Lewis “Mac” McLeod on Dec. 31, 1946. She served as Regent of RAMASOC Chapter, Maine Society, Daughters of the American Revolution of Bucksport three times. She was past president of American Legion Auxiliary Post No. 12. past president of the Winterport Health Council, past president of the Winterport Historical Society, past president of the Small Library of Maine Association. Cora served 22 years as town librarian at the Winterport Memorial Library. She was a member and twice served as Regent of Cushing Chapter of OES. She was always active in town, county and state affairs and enjoyed knitting, sewing, gardening, cooking, volunteering in the community and traveling with her family She is survived by two sons, William L. McLeod of Mt. Hally, N.C., Nat B. McLeod of Winterport; one grandson, Patric McLeod of Burlington, Vt. She was predeceased by her husband of 54 years, “Mac” in 2001. At her request private interment will be in the family lot at Oak Hill Cemetery. In lieu of flowers memorial gifts may be donated to any fund promoting child literacy. Foley Funeral Service, Bangor is conducting the arrangements for the family.
